The Children in Year 2 and 5 were extremely excited to display their award winning Upcycled Sensory Garden at the RHS Chatsworth Show last week. The children had spent so much time sharing their ideas, designing and building the final piece. We were so proud of all their hard work and the fantastically creative ideas which they translated into the finished design. After transporting our garden to the show last Tuesday and realising that 40 other schools were taking part in the Gardening for Schools Awards, we waited patiently to see if the public liked and enjoyed our design. As it turns out they absolutely did and … we won!!!

We are so incredibly proud of the children and to have their work recognised in this way is a very special moment for all the staff involved. As a school we now receive a Garden Centre voucher for £200, a beautiful Wedgwood Planter and a Plaque in recognition of the children’s achievement.
